Germany Leipzig Autumn Fair 1965 Stamp

Issue:        Germany Leipzig Autumn Fair 1965 Stamp

Type:       Stamp

Number of Stamps:        1

Denominations:          15 PF,

Issue Date:          1965

Issued By:       Germany Deutsche Post ( Deutschland )

 

 

 

History and Background:

The Germany Leipzig Autumn Fair stamp is a remarkable issue that highlights the long tradition of Leipzig as a major European trade and exhibition city. The Leipzig Fair has roots dating back to the Middle Ages and by the twentieth century it had grown into one of the most significant international fairs in Europe. The stamp was issued to celebrate the autumn event and to showcase the importance of trade culture and international cooperation. The design reflects the spirit of the fair by displaying symbols of commerce progress and modernity. This stamp became an ambassador for Germany demonstrating not only the importance of Leipzig but also the way stamps communicate history and cultural exchange to the world.
